While there are significant risks from the use of AI in health, there are also significant risks from not taking action to operationalise agreed principles. This brief outlines the key opportunities for AI to improve health outcomes, critical risks to be addressed in its deployment in health, and proposes practical policy action to operationalise responsible AI that respects human rights and improves health outcomes within and across borders.
